Considerations before hiking in steel toe boots

Before embarking on a hiking adventure in steel toe boots, there are a few important factors to consider. Firstly, it is crucial to ensure that the boots provide the necessary protection and support for your feet. Look for boots that have a reinforced steel toe cap and a sturdy sole to prevent any potential injuries. Additionally, consider the weight of the boots as they may be heavier than regular hiking boots. This extra weight can impact your overall comfort and mobility on the trail. Lastly, keep in mind that steel toe boots may not be suitable for all types of terrain. They are best suited for rugged and rocky trails where there is a higher risk of falling objects or crushing hazards. Disadvantages of hiking in steel toe boots

While there are some drawbacks to hiking in steel toe boots, I personally find that the benefits outweigh the negatives. One of the main disadvantages is the added weight of the boots, which can make long hikes more tiring. Additionally, the steel toe can restrict movement and flexibility, making it harder to navigate uneven terrain. However, I’ve found that with the right pair of boots and some adjustments to my hiking style, these disadvantages can be minimized. For example, I make sure to choose boots with a lightweight design and proper arch support to reduce fatigue. I also take extra care to maintain good balance and posture while hiking in steel toe boots. Overall, while there are challenges to overcome, I believe that hiking in steel toe boots can be a rewarding experience for those who prioritize safety and protection.

Exploring alternative hiking footwear options

After considering the pros and cons of hiking in steel toe boots, I have decided to explore alternative hiking footwear options. While steel toe boots provide excellent protection, they can be heavy and rigid, making them less suitable for long hikes. Additionally, they may not provide the same level of comfort and flexibility as hiking shoes or boots. Therefore, I am looking into other options that offer a balance between protection and comfort. Some alternatives I am considering are hiking shoes with reinforced toe caps or composite toe boots. These options provide similar protection to steel toe boots while being lighter and more flexible. I am also researching hiking sandals with sturdy soles and good traction, as they can be a great choice for shorter hikes or hot weather conditions.
